Spamzilla.com sold for $35,000


The domain name spamzilla.com has been sold from Essatte Ltd., Hong Kong, to International Software Systems Solutions, Florida. Market Evolver Ltd. organized the sale.

"We are definitely seeing a rebound in the value of domain names.' said Steven Tracy, Market Evolver's C.T.O. "This time last year it was rare to see a domain name go for more than $10,000. In the last few months there have been dozens of them. I expect that we will see many more high value sales this year."

"International Software Systems Solutions" (what a mouthful) has a product called "StopZilla" so I guess spamzilla is worth $35k in some warped way to them.

I get the strange feeling this was not a pure cash deal with immediate payment. High price domain sales for strange domain names, seems to be a good way to get free advertising these days...
